EQUIPMENT NEEDED

To make Shamrock Pretzels, you will need some basic equipment. Here is what you will need:

  • Baking sheet
  • Parchment paper
  • Microwave-safe bowl
  • Heatproof spatula or spoon
  • Fork (optional, for dipping)

Ingredients You’ll Need :

  • 1 bag of pretzels
  • 1 cup of white chocolate chips
  • Green food coloring
  • Sprinkles (optional)
  • Chocolate candies (for decoration, optional)

STEP-BY-STEP INSTRUCTIONS :

  1. Preheat your oven to 200°F (90°C).
  2. Place the pretzels on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.
  3. In a microwave-safe bowl, melt the white chocolate chips, stirring every 30 seconds until smooth.
  4. Add a few drops of green food coloring to the melted chocolate and mix until fully combined.
  5. Dip each pretzel into the green chocolate, ensuring it is fully coated.
  6. Place the coated pretzels back on the baking sheet.
  7. If desired, add sprinkles or chocolate candies on top before the chocolate sets.
  8. Allow the pretzels to cool and harden completely before serving.

STORAGE & FREEZING : Shamrock Pretzels

To store your Shamrock Pretzels, place them in an airtight container. They can sit at room temperature for about a week without losing their taste. If you want to keep them longer, you can freeze them. Just make sure to let them cool and harden fully first. Place them in a freezer bag or container, and they can last up to three months. When you’re ready to enjoy them again, let them thaw at room temperature.

VARIATIONS

There are many ways to change up the Shamrock Pretzels. You can use different colors of food coloring to match any holiday or theme. Instead of green, try red for Christmas or pink for Valentine’s Day. You can also experiment with different types of chocolate like dark or milk chocolate.

For those who want a little kick, add a sprinkle of sea salt on top before the chocolate hardens. You can also mix in crushed candy canes or nuts for added texture and flavor. If you want to make these pretzels even more festive, use themed sprinkles related to the occasion.

FAQs

Shamrock Pretzels

1. Can I use regular chocolate instead of white chocolate?
Yes, you can use regular chocolate, but make sure to adjust the colors accordingly. You may want to use darker colors to contrast with the chocolate.

2. What type of pretzels works best for this recipe?
Any pretzels will work! Traditional pretzels or pretzel sticks are popular choices. Choose your favorite shape.

3. How do I store leftover Shamrock Pretzels?
Keep them in an airtight container for up to a week. You can also freeze them for up to three months for longer storage.

4. Can I make these pretzels gluten-free?
Yes! Just use gluten-free pretzels to make this recipe suitable for gluten-sensitive individuals.
